Monica Ahluwalia's research delves into the innovative application of machine learning techniques to enhance our understanding of hypertrophic cardiomyopathy and to develop advanced risk stratification tools tailored for diverse populations. As an Assistant Professor of Cardiovascular Medicine at Boston University, she combines her academic pursuits with her practical experience as a Staff Cardiologist at Boston Medical Center. Her dual roles allow her to bridge the gap between cutting-edge research and patient care, ensuring that her findings have a direct impact on improving clinical outcomes. In addition to her academic and clinical responsibilities, Dr. Ahluwalia serves as an Advanced Heart Failure & Transplant Cardiologist at Brigham and Women's Hospital. Her work in this capacity underscores her commitment to tackling complex cardiovascular conditions and contributing to the advancement of heart failure management and transplant cardiology. Dr. Ahluwalia's contributions to the field are recognized through her active membership in prestigious organizations such as the American College of Cardiology, the American Heart Association, and the Heart Failure Society of America.
